Six players score in double figures as Tennessee rolls

Nov 12, 2006 - 11:09 PM KNOXVILLE, Tennessee (Ticker) -- Alexis Hornbuckle scored 19 points to lead six players in double figures as No. 5 Tennessee posted a comfortable 102-72 victory over Chattanooga in its season opener.

Hornbuckle made 6-of-9 shots from the field, including a pair of 3-pointers, and added seven of Tennessee's 17 steals.

Candace Parker scored 15 points, Alberta Auguste added 13 and Shannon Bobbitt 12 for the Lady Vols, who shot nearly 58 percent (33-of-57) and never trailed.

Dominique Redding chipped in 11 and Sidney Spencer 10 for Tennessee.

Brooke Hand scored 20 points to pace Chattanooga (1-1), which shot 43 percent (25-of-58) and committed 26 turnovers.
